Table 1 A collection of magnetocalorific HEAs with different structures in recent years
|
|
| Alloy | Structure | Applied field | $\left| {{\Delta }S_{{\text{M}}} } \right|$ (J/kg/K) | RC (J/kg) | References | | | FeCoNi1.5Cr0.5Al | BCC | 70 kOe | 0.674 | 242.6 | [50] | | Fe26.7Ni26.7Ga15.6Mn20Si11 | BCC | 2 T | 1.59 | 75.86 | [51] | | Fe25Co25Ni25Mo5P10B10 | BMG | 5 T | 1.88 | 310.2 | [52] | | Gd20Ho20Er20Al20Co20 | BMG | 5 T | 10.2 | 625 | [53] | | Gd20Tb20Dy20Al20Co20 | BMG | 5 T | 9.43 | 632 | [54] | | Gd25Ho25Co25Al25 | BMG | 5 T | 9.78 | 626 | [55] | | Dy20Er20Gd20Ho20Tb20 | HCP | 5 T | 8.6 | 627 | [49] |
